sparsenet-package | R Documentation |
Sparsenet uses coordinate descent on the MC+ nonconvex penalty family, and fits a surface of solutions over the two-dimensional parameter space.
At its simplest, provide x,y
data and it returns the solution
paths. There are tools for prediction, cross-validation, plotting and printing.

x=matrix(rnorm(100*20),100,20)
y=rnorm(100)
fit=sparsenet(x,y)
plot(fit)
cvfit=cv.sparsenet(x,y)
plot(cvfit)
